Quick Hits The congressionally chartered
National Security Commission on Artificial Intelligence submitted its final report on March 1. In the introduction, chairman
Eric Schmidt and vice chairman
Robert Work caution about the rise of lethal AI among U.S. adversaries and argues that we will not be able to defend against AI-enabled threats without ubiquitous AI capabilities and new warfighting paradigms. The
General Services Administrationannounced a share of a Bitcoin will be part of an upcoming auction. The sale marks the first time GSA counted a cryptocurrency product among its auction items.

The Senate included close to $2 billion for federal cybersecurity and technology modernization programs in its version of President Biden's proposed COVID-19 relief package.The funds fall short of the more than $10 billion originally proposed by Biden in his American Rescue Plan, but far more than the House included in the version it approved along party lines earlier this week.
